Junio C Hamano wrote:
> Matthias Lederhofer <matled@gmx•net> writes:
>
>
>>Junio C Hamano wrote:
>>
>>>I see you are trying hard to think of a way to justify your
>>>original prefix "--and" (or --FOO) implementation, but I simply
>>>do not see much point in that. I doubt changing the default
>>>operator from --or to --and is less confusing than changing the
>>>precedence for the users, so you would hear the same "I
>>>personally feel FOO should not even exist" objection from me.
>>
>>It just happens to make more sense to me and I don't see a reason not to
>>add this. If no one else is interested in this I'll just stop arguing :)
>>Here again an overview of the arguments if anyone is interested:
>>- Less to type for common searches using only AND (or more ANDs than
>> ORs).
>>- Easy to implement (both with and without extended expressions).
>>- AND/* is the normal implicit operator in other contexts than grep
>> (math).
>>- The high precedence operator (AND) should be implicit rather than
>> the low precedence one (OR) (so this is only fulfilled when the
>> option is used).
>
>
> Side note. It would be interesting to have a slightly different
> form of --and called --near. You would use it like this:
>
> git grep -C -e AND --near -e OR
>
> to find lines that has AND on it, and within the context
> distance there is a line that has OR on it. The lines that are
> hit with such a query are still the ones that have AND on them
> (in other words, a line that has OR is used to further filter
> out the results so it will be prefixed with '-', not ':', unless
> that line happens to also have AND on it).
>
It would also be neat to have --inside main or some such, to make it
only check for things inside whatever's printed on the diff --git line.
